Islamabad: The US dollar started the business week with a slight depreciation, dropping by 1 paisa in the interbank exchange. 

Now, 1 paisa buys $278.20, compared to the previous rate of $278.21 at the end of the last business week.

Simultaneously, the Pakistan Stock Exchange is showing a promising trend as the Pakistan Stock Exchange 100 index surged by 834 points to reach 72,736 points.

This marks a notable increase from the closing figure of 71,902 points recorded at the end of the previous business week.
